Two seasoned reef-keepers trade banter and practical wisdom across episodes, balancing hands-on husbandry with business realities. Frequent threads include gear choices, maintenance routines, disaster planning, and navigating sponsor relationships, all delivered with humor and candidness. The show often features guests and expert perspectives that illuminate data interpretation, taxonomy, and ethics in the hobby, while also exploring community dynamics, travel for events, and the day-to-day challenges of running reef-related services. Unique strengths include a frank, unpolished style that pairs entertaining storytelling with actionable tips, plus a strong emphasis on accountability and real-world client work.
